Have you ever wondered why some technologies thrive while others struggle to keep up? In the world of distributed ledger technology, this question is more relevant than ever. Traditional systems have paved the way for secure and efficient data sharing, but emerging alternatives are challenging the status quo.
Take transaction speed, for example. While older systems handle around 7 transactions per second, newer solutions can process over 1,000. This stark difference highlights the growing debate between established methods and innovative approaches.
Both systems aim to solve similar problems, but their methods vary. Security, scalability, and energy efficiency are key factors to consider. This guide will help you understand these differences and choose the best solution for your needs.
Blockchain Vs Blockdag: Which is Better for Your Needs?
The evolution of data-sharing technologies has introduced diverse architectures. Traditional systems like blockchain technology rely on a linear sequence of blocks. Each block is validated using mechanisms like Proof-of-Work (PoW) or Proof-of-Stake (PoS). This structure ensures security but can limit speed and scalability.
In contrast, BlockDAG uses a directed acyclic graph (DAG) structure. Instead of a single chain, it allows multiple blocks to be processed simultaneously. This web-like design enables faster confirmations. For example, Kaspa achieves 1-block-per-second confirmations, while Bitcoin takes 10 minutes per block.
The DAG structure also prevents forks by allowing blocks to reference multiple “parents.” This reduces conflicts and enhances efficiency. Despite these advantages, many institutions still prefer traditional blockchains due to their proven reliability and widespread adoption.
To dive deeper into the differences, check out this comparative analysis. Understanding these architectures will help you choose the right solution for your needs.
Understanding Blockchain Architecture
When it comes to secure data management, understanding the underlying architecture is crucial. A blockchain is a decentralized ledger that records transactions in a series of blocks. Each block is linked to the previous one, forming a chain that ensures data integrity and transparency.
What is a Blockchain?
A blockchain consists of multiple blocks, each containing transaction data, a timestamp, and a cryptographic hash. The hash connects each block to the previous one, creating an immutable record. This structure prevents tampering, as altering one block would require changing all subsequent blocks.
Key Elements of Blockchain
To fully grasp how blockchain works, let’s break down its key components:
- Block Headers: Contain metadata like timestamps and the previous block’s hash.
- Merkle Trees: Organize transaction data for efficient verification.
- Cryptographic Hashing: Ensures immutability by linking blocks securely.
Consensus mechanisms like Proof-of-Work (PoW) and Proof-of-Stake (PoS) validate transactions. PoW, used by Bitcoin, requires significant energy but ensures high security. PoS, adopted by Ethereum, is more energy-efficient and scalable.
However, PoW systems are vulnerable to 51% attacks, where a single entity gains control of the majority of the network’s mining power. In contrast, BlockDAG’s sybil resistance reduces such risks by allowing multiple blocks to coexist.
Ethereum’s transition to PoS has significantly reduced gas fees, making it a more cost-effective solution. For example, gas fees dropped from $50 to under $1 during peak usage after the transition.
Exploring BlockDAG Architecture
Innovative data structures are reshaping how we handle digital transactions. Unlike traditional systems, BlockDAG introduces a directed acyclic graph (DAG) structure. This design allows multiple blocks to be processed simultaneously, improving speed and scalability.
What is a Directed Acyclic Graph (DAG)?
A DAG is a network of nodes where each node connects to multiple others without forming cycles. This structure enables parallel blocks to coexist, unlike linear chains. For example, IoT devices can use DAGs to process data faster and more efficiently.
What is a BlockDAG?
BlockDAG builds on the DAG concept by allowing blocks to reference multiple “parent” blocks. This prevents forks and enhances transaction speed. Kaspa, for instance, uses the GHOSTDAG protocol to achieve over 100 transactions per second (TPS).
Here’s how BlockDAG works:
- PHANTOM Protocol: Classifies blocks as blue (confirmed) or red (unconfirmed) to streamline validation.
- Taraxa: Implements smart contracts on DAG for decentralized applications.
- Kaspa vs. Aleph Zero: Kaspa uses Proof-of-Work (PoW), while Aleph Zero employs Proof-of-Stake (PoS) for energy efficiency.
- XELIS: Offers 15-second blocks with enhanced privacy features.
BlockDAG’s flexibility makes it a promising solution for modern data-sharing needs. Its ability to handle high TPS and reduce conflicts sets it apart from traditional systems.
Blockchain Vs BlockDAG: Key Differences
Choosing the right technology for your needs requires understanding the key differences between systems. While both aim to secure and share data, their approaches vary significantly. Let’s break down the main distinctions to help you decide which one suits your goals.
First, the structure is a major factor. Traditional blockchain systems use a linear sequence of chain blocks. Each block links to the previous one, creating a secure but slower process. In contrast, BlockDAG employs a web-like formation, allowing multiple blocks to be processed simultaneously. This design boosts speed and scalability.
Energy consumption is another critical difference. Bitcoin, a leading blockchain, uses 127 TWh/year for mining. BlockDAG systems like Kaspa optimize Proof-of-Work (PoW) to reduce energy usage significantly. This makes BlockDAG a more sustainable choice for high-volume transactions.
Security risks also vary. Blockchain systems are vulnerable to 51% attacks, where a single entity controls most of the network’s power. BlockDAG minimizes this risk by allowing multiple blocks to coexist, reducing the chance of such attacks.
Decentralization is another area of contrast. Ethereum relies on thousands of nodes for validation, ensuring robust decentralization. BlockDAG, however, requires fewer validators, which can streamline the process but may raise concerns about centralization.
Here’s a quick summary of the key differences:
- Structure: Linear chains vs. web-like formations.
- Energy Use: High consumption in Bitcoin vs. optimized efficiency in Kaspa.
- Security: 51% attack risks vs. low-activity vulnerabilities.
- Decentralization: Thousands of nodes vs. fewer validators.
Understanding these differences will help you choose the right system for your needs. Whether you prioritize speed, sustainability, or security, each technology offers unique advantages.
Performance Comparison: Blockchain Vs BlockDAG
When evaluating technologies, performance metrics are the ultimate deciding factor. Both systems have unique strengths, but understanding their differences can help you make an informed choice. Let’s dive into key areas like throughput, security, and resource requirements.
Throughput and Transaction Speed
Speed is a critical factor in any system. Traditional networks like Ethereum handle around 30 transactions per second (TPS). In contrast, BlockDAG systems like Kaspa achieve over 1,000 TPS. This significant difference highlights the advantage of parallel processing in BlockDAG.
Blockchain systems often face bottlenecks due to their linear structure. Mempool systems can become congested, delaying transactions. BlockDAG’s design reduces orphaned blocks by 89%, ensuring smoother operations even during high-demand events like NFT mints.
Security and Decentralization
Security is another vital consideration. Blockchain networks rely on thousands of nodes for validation, ensuring robust decentralization. However, they are vulnerable to 51% attacks, where a single entity gains majority control.
BlockDAG minimizes this risk by allowing multiple blocks to coexist. This design reduces the chance of attacks while maintaining high scalability. However, fewer validators in BlockDAG systems may raise concerns about centralization.
Resource Requirements and Efficiency
Energy consumption and hardware needs are crucial for long-term sustainability. Bitcoin, for example, requires significant energy for mining, using 127 TWh/year. BlockDAG systems optimize Proof-of-Work (PoW) to reduce energy usage significantly.
Hardware requirements also differ. Bitcoin nodes demand substantial storage, while BlockDAG systems are more efficient in resource use. This makes BlockDAG a cost-effective solution for high-volume transactions.
Here’s a quick comparison of key metrics:
- Bitcoin: 7 TPS, high energy use, extensive hardware needs.
- Ethereum: 30 TPS, moderate energy use, scalable with PoS.
- Kaspa: 1,000+ TPS, optimized energy use, efficient storage.
Understanding these performance differences will help you choose the right system for your needs. Whether you prioritize speed, security, or efficiency, each technology offers unique advantages.
Use Cases for Blockchain and BlockDAG
Different technologies excel in unique ways, each offering distinct advantages for specific applications. Let’s explore how blockchain and BlockDAG are transforming industries with their specialized use cases.
Blockchain Use Cases
Blockchain technology dominates sectors requiring secure and transparent transactions. Here are some key applications:
- Decentralized Finance (DeFi): Ethereum’s $22B DeFi ecosystem enables peer-to-peer lending, borrowing, and trading without intermediaries.
- Institutional Finance: Banks and financial institutions use blockchain for cross-border payments and asset tokenization.
- Identity Management: Blockchain ensures secure and verifiable digital identities, reducing fraud and enhancing privacy.
For example, Walmart uses blockchain to track food supply chains, ensuring transparency and safety from farm to store.
BlockDAG Use Cases
BlockDAG’s parallel processing capabilities make it ideal for high-speed and scalable applications. Here’s where it shines:
- IoT Micropayments: Taraxa leverages BlockDAG for machine-to-machine payments, enabling seamless transactions between devices.
- Gaming: Play-to-earn games use BlockDAG for fast and secure in-game transactions, enhancing user experience.
- Supply Chain: DAG alternatives offer faster and more efficient tracking compared to traditional blockchain systems.
Kaspa, a leading BlockDAG platform, focuses on scalable and secure payment systems, making it a strong contender for modern applications.
Hybrid models like Polygon combine blockchain’s reliability with DAG-inspired solutions, offering the best of both worlds. To learn more about these technologies, check out this detailed comparison.
Technical Implementation of BlockDAG
Implementing advanced technologies requires a deep understanding of their underlying mechanics. BlockDAG’s unique architecture offers scalability and speed, but its technical implementation comes with specific challenges and considerations.
Consensus Mechanisms in BlockDAG
BlockDAG relies on innovative consensus mechanisms to validate transactions efficiently. Kaspa, for example, uses the GHOSTDAG protocol, which allows for high throughput and low latency. Aleph Zero combines DAG with Byzantine Fault Tolerance (BFT) for enhanced security and scalability.
SPECTRE introduces a voting-based confirmation system, enabling faster transaction finality. PHANTOM, on the other hand, resolves conflicts by classifying blocks as blue (confirmed) or red (unconfirmed). These mechanisms ensure that BlockDAG systems remain secure and efficient even under high loads.
Challenges in BlockDAG Implementation
Despite its advantages, BlockDAG faces several implementation challenges. Storage is a significant concern, as 1 million transactions per second can generate up to 2.5 terabytes of daily data. This requires robust infrastructure and efficient data management solutions.
Regulatory uncertainty also poses a challenge. The SEC’s stance on DAG tokens remains unclear, creating potential hurdles for adoption. Additionally, the complexity of implementing BlockDAG systems, such as Kaspa nodes, can be higher compared to traditional Ethereum clients.
Here’s a quick overview of the key challenges:
- Storage: High transaction volumes demand scalable storage solutions.
- Regulation: Unclear guidelines from regulatory bodies like the SEC.
- Complexity: Implementation requires advanced technical expertise.
Understanding these challenges is crucial for anyone considering BlockDAG for their needs. By addressing these issues, we can unlock the full potential of this innovative technology.
Future Outlook for Blockchain and BlockDAG
The future of digital ledger technologies is evolving rapidly, with both traditional blockchain and emerging solutions shaping the landscape. Enterprises are increasingly adopting these technologies, with 78% still favoring blockchain for its proven reliability. However, the BlockDAG market is projected to grow at a 38.7% CAGR through 2030, signaling a shift toward more scalable and efficient systems.
Enterprise adoption trends, as highlighted in IBM and Microsoft reports, show a growing interest in hybrid solutions. Layer 2 technologies are expected to bridge the gap between blockchain and DAG architectures, offering the best of both worlds. This convergence could redefine how we approach scalability and transaction speed in crypto networks.
Quantum computing poses a significant threat to both architectures. Its ability to break cryptographic algorithms could compromise security. Developers are already working on quantum-resistant solutions to safeguard these systems for the future.
Central Bank Digital Currencies (CBDCs) are another area of potential. While China’s Digital Yuan relies on blockchain, BlockDAG-based alternatives could offer faster and more scalable solutions for global adoption. This could revolutionize how governments handle digital currencies.
Finally, Visa’s need for 24/7 settlement systems presents a unique opportunity for BlockDAG. Its high throughput and low latency make it an ideal candidate for real-time payment processing, addressing one of the financial industry’s most pressing challenges.
- Enterprise Adoption: Blockchain remains dominant, but BlockDAG is gaining traction.
- Layer 2 Convergence: Hybrid solutions could combine the strengths of both technologies.
- Quantum Threats: Both systems face risks from quantum computing advancements.
- CBDC Potential: BlockDAG could offer faster and more scalable alternatives.
- Visa’s Opportunity: BlockDAG’s efficiency aligns with the need for 24/7 settlements.
As these technologies evolve, their applications will continue to expand, offering new possibilities for industries worldwide. Staying informed about these trends will help you make the best decisions for your needs.
Conclusion
Deciding between technologies often comes down to balancing speed and security. For high-value settlements, traditional systems remain the preferred choice due to their proven reliability. On the other hand, newer architectures excel in high-throughput scenarios, making them ideal for applications like IoT and gaming.
When evaluating your needs, consider the frequency and value of your transactions. Financial institutions may benefit from the security of established systems, while industries requiring fast, scalable solutions should explore alternatives. Both technologies have unique strengths, and the right choice depends on your specific goals.
Looking ahead, innovations like zero-knowledge DAGs promise to enhance privacy and efficiency further. These advancements could bridge the gap between speed and security, offering even more tailored solutions.
To get started, assess your project’s requirements and test both systems in real-world scenarios. This hands-on approach will help you make an informed decision and choose the best technology for your needs.